S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:

A. Purpose

    The Transfer Order--Surplus Personal Property and Continuation 
Sheet, Standard form (SF) 123, is used by a State Agency for Surplus 
Property (SASP) to donate Federal surplus personal property to public 
agencies, nonprofit educational or public health activities, programs 
for the elderly, service educational activities, and public airports. 
The SF 123 serves as the transfer instrument and includes item 
descriptions, transportation instructions, nondiscrimination 
assurances, and approval signatures.

B. Annual Reporting Burden

    Respondents (electronic): 30,890.
    Respondents (manual): 312.
    Total Number of Respondents: 31,202.
    Total Hours per Response (electronic at .017 Hours per Response): 
525.13.
    Total Hours per Response (manual at .13 Hours per Response): 40.56.
    Total Burden Hours: 565.69.
